Day-to-day Roles and Responsibilities:
- Teach an energetic and motivating class, connect and challenge each child, and help them to accomplish motor development goals.
- Effectively and clearly communicate issues to the office and provide solutions.
- Show up on time to class.
- Equipment set-up and break-down.
- Provide hands-on individual and group attention to children.
Qualifications:
- Expressive, charismatic, and nurturing personality.
- Responsible, dedicated, and confident individuals with a strong work ethic.
- High energy!
- Comfort with managing groups of children and adults.
- Ability to follow curriculum and tailor lessons to specific developmental levels.
- No coaching or soccer experience required!

How to prepare for a job interview at Super Soccer Stars
β¨Know Your Audience
Before the interview, take some time to understand the values and mission of Super Soccer Stars. Theyβre all about creating a diverse and inclusive environment, so think about how your experiences align with that. Be ready to share examples of how youβve worked in multicultural settings or embraced diversity in your previous roles.
β¨Show Your Energy
As a Youth Soccer Instructor, high energy is key! During the interview, let your enthusiasm shine through. Use expressive body language and a lively tone when discussing your passion for working with children. This will help convey that youβre the right fit for their energetic classes.
β¨Prepare for Scenario Questions
Expect questions that assess your ability to manage groups of children and communicate effectively. Think of specific scenarios where youβve had to handle challenges or adapt your approach. Practising these responses will help you feel more confident and articulate during the interview.
β¨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, donβt forget to ask questions! Inquire about the training process, how they support their instructors, or what a typical day looks like.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you determine if itβs the right fit for you.
